  • The Mystery of the Sea Chapter 31 - Marjory's Adventure
    Apr 4 2026
    In which the narrator daringly explores a deep and narrow cavern passage beneath a hill, discovering a secret way to an ancient chapel and cleverly devising a system to monitor the movements of mysterious kidnappers. A tense but joyous reunion with Marjory follows, who recounts her own harrowing adventure in the dark tunnels, proving her fearless spirit and steady resolve amidst perilous circumstances.

  • The Mystery of the Sea Chapter 30 - The Secret Passage
    Apr 3 2026
    In which the careful laying of delicate threads reveals signs of clandestine movement near the monument, prompting a cautious investigation that uncovers the possibility of a hidden, movable stone concealing a secret passage. Equipped with resolve and a lamp, the narrator ventures into this ancient subterranean way, noting its natural origin yet enhanced by human hand, and discovers a bifurcation leading towards the sound of running water.

  • The Mystery of the Sea Chapter 29 - The Monument
    Apr 2 2026
    In which the narrator, seized by a sombre curiosity, explores the hill near the old chapel and discovers a weathered monument beside a hidden reservoir, pondering secret passages and the possibility of clandestine communication. He and Marjory devise a clever signalling system between the castle and the monument, sharing tender moments midst their growing peril and affection.
